Pedal Valves





Business Profile: Contact Information, Customer Reviews, Rating & Accreditation, Customer Complaints, Business Details

Photos

Pedal Valves




Description

Pedal Valves, Inc: Main

Pedal Valves, Inc. -- Pedal Valves provides world class project management and support for facilities, companies, and municipalities interested in saving money and the environment by conserving energy.

Contacts

Address:
13625 River Rd, Luling, LA 70070






Features

Wheelchair accessible entrance
Wheelchair accessible parking lot
Debit cards
Credit cards





Reviews

Write a review

Related